Charging Inoperative

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2011 Buick Regal.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. Ignition OFF, disconnect the X1 connector at the X91 Mobile Telephone Connector.
  2. Ignition OFF, test for less than 5 Ω between the low reference circuit terminal 1 X1 and ground.
    • If greater than the specified range, test the low reference circuit for an open/high resistance. If the circuit tests normal, replace the K82 Mobile Telephone Control Module.
  3. Ignition ON, test for greater than 11 V between the 12 V reference circuit terminal 3 X1 and ground.
    • If less than the specified range, test the 12 V reference circuit for a short to ground or an open/high resistance. If the circuit tests normal, replace the K82 Mobile Telephone Control Module.
  4. If all circuits test normal, replace the X91 Mobile Telephone Connector.
